المستخلص: The aim of the present study was to translate and assess the reliability and validity of the Theory of Mind task battery designed by Hutchins & Prelock 2010, for use as an assessment of the theory of mind in normally-developing children, such behavior has implications on many aspects of children’s life, such as social competence, peer acceptance and early success in school. 367 normally-developing monolingual children ranging in age from 3 to 12 years participated. A back-to-back translation method was used with the theory of mind task battery. A subset of 49 children participated in a retest 10 to 14 days after the initial assessment. Overall results indicated that the Arabic adaptation of the test can be considered reliable for assessing theory of mind within children. However, analyses of item difficulty indicated some differences between the Arabic adaptation of the theory of mind task battery and the English test, therefore, the arrangement of the tasks was changed and task D (Line of sight) was moved and became the last task tested because it was the most difficult for all ages.
